The Belarusian Ruble (BYN), the official currency of Belarus, is a symbol of the nation’s economic journey and resilience. It is commonly abbreviated as BYN and represented by the symbol Br. With its complex history and pivotal role in Belarus's economy, the Ruble offers a unique insight into the challenges and triumphs of this Eastern European country.
Historical Background
The Belarusian Ruble was introduced shortly after the country gained independence following the dissolution of the Soviet Union in 1991. This change marked a significant moment in Belarus’s history, as the nation sought to establish its own identity and economic autonomy. The early years of the Ruble were marked by hyperinflation and economic instability, mirroring the tumultuous transition from a Soviet republic to an independent state.
Design and Symbolism
The design of the Belarusian Ruble reflects the country’s cultural heritage and national identity. The notes and coins feature prominent historical figures, landmarks, and national symbols. For instance, the Mir Castle and the Nesvizh Castle, both UNESCO World Heritage Sites, are depicted on certain denominations, symbolizing Belarus's rich historical legacy. These designs serve not just as monetary instruments but also as a reminder of the nation's past and its cultural richness.
Economic Role and Value
The Ruble plays a crucial role in the Belarusian economy, facilitating trade and investment within the country. Over the years, the government and the National Bank of Belarus have implemented various reforms to stabilize the currency and control inflation. These efforts have been critical in building confidence in the Ruble and ensuring its functionality as a reliable medium of exchange.
Monetary Reforms and Redenomination
Belarus has undergone several redenominations of its currency, a response to historical periods of high inflation. The most recent redenomination in 2016 aimed to simplify transactions and restore public confidence in the national currency. This move was also part of broader economic reforms intended to stabilize and modernize the Belarusian economy.

What factors influence the conversion rate of HOMS to BYN?
There are many factors that affect the relationship between HOMSTOKEN and Belarusian Ruble, spanning multiple dimensions such as macroeconomic trends, policy regulation, and technological innovation. Specifically, the following key factors play an important role:
Market sentiment:Investor sentiment and confidence have a significant impact on the dynamics of HOMS/BYN. When there is positive news in the market about the widespread adoption of HOMS or major technological breakthroughs, it tends to trigger market optimism and drive the rise of HOMS/BYN. Conversely, negative news, such as regulatory crackdowns and security vulnerabilities, may trigger market panic and lead to a decline in HOMS/BYN.
Regulatory environment:Government policies and regulations surrounding cryptocurrencies have a direct impact on their acceptance, which in turn determines their value relative to traditional currencies such as the US dollar. Clear and supportive regulations can enhance investor confidence in cryptocurrencies and drive their value up. Conversely, vague or overly strict regulatory policies may hinder the development of cryptocurrencies and cause their value to fall.
Economic indicators:Macroeconomic factors in the country where the fiat currency is issued—such as inflation rates, interest rates, and key economic growth indicators—play a crucial role in determining the fiat currency's value and indirectly affect the exchange rate of HOMS/BYN. For example, high inflation rates may lead to a decrease in market trust in fiat currencies, thereby increasing investors' demand for c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in as a hedge, driving up their prices.
Technological progress:The continuous development and innovation of blockchain technology, as well as various improvements in the cryptocurrency ecosystem—such as expansion solutions and security enhancements—have provided strong support for the value growth of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in.
